The capital - Nicosia - continues to attract world class banks, financial services organisations and management accountancy firms as a base for their operations in the wider Eastern Mediterranean region.Although Cyprus is renowned for its superb sub-tropical weather, it is no coincidence that it also enjoys a well earned reputation for having a friendly financial climate.With some of the lowest levels of personal and corporation tax in Europe, the authorities in Cyprus promote a welcoming and positive attitude towards commerce - and the role the played by the individual in achieving economic success. The benefits extend to people and organisations choosing to establish or transfer their business interests and tax domicile to the country. Cyprus enjoys double taxation treaties with forty countries and is aligned with those progressive economies with sights set firmly on future growth and prosperity.Retirement here is a financial pleasure, with generous allowances and a nominal 5% personal taxation rate on pension income. The absence of Inheritance Tax means that, although 'you can't take it with you', what you do leave behind can be for the benefit of those you choose.For these reasons alone, Cyprus merits serious consideration as a location for permanent living or tax residency.
